Factors Influencing Family Legislation Attorney Fees
When you're taking into consideration hiring a family law attorney, numerous variables can affect their charges.
Initially, the attorney's experience and reputation play a considerable function; seasoned attorneys typically charge extra due to their proven performance history.
The complexity of your situation also matters; uncomplicated matters typically incur reduced fees, while intricate situations can rise prices.
In addition, area effects rates-- city lawyers may bill greater prices than those in rural areas.
The attorney's billing framework is one more factor to consider; some cost per hour, while others may offer level fees or retainer agreements.
Lastly, office expenses and support team can impact expenses, as bigger firms often tend to have higher operational expenditures.
Added Costs to Think About When Working With a Family Members Regulation Lawyer
While working with a family members regulation lawyer, it's vital to be aware of extra expenses that may occur beyond their conventional costs.
As an example, court filing fees can build up rapidly, usually ranging from $200 to $500, depending upon your jurisdiction. You might additionally run into costs for arbitration sessions, which can run in between $100 to $300 per hour.
